 |
www.elektronik.si Forum o elektrotehniki in računalništvu
|
Poglej prejšnjo temo :: Poglej naslednjo temo |
Avtor |
Sporočilo |
twom Član


Pridružen-a: Ned 26 Okt 2003 0:37 Prispevkov: 986 Aktiv.: 4.15 Kraj: Ljubljana
|
Objavljeno: Sre Maj 28, 2008 1:15 pm Naslov sporočila: C++ for zanka |
|
|
Zanima me če v Cju obstaja zanka, ki bi delovala kot naslednji ''for''
for (i = 0, 1, 2, 3, 5, 7, 11, 13, 17, 19, 23, 29, 31, 37, 41, 43)
V podobnih primerih sedaj uporabljam
for (i =0, i<100,i++)
if i == 0
if i == 1
itd
Lp,
Peter |
|
Nazaj na vrh |
|
 |
VolkD Član


 
Pridružen-a: Pet 24 Sep 2004 21:58 Prispevkov: 14228 Aktiv.: 59.89 Kraj: Divača (Kačiče)
|
Objavljeno: Sre Maj 28, 2008 2:12 pm Naslov sporočila: |
|
|
Haha.. praštevila..
Rešitev je seveda več. Je pa še eno dodatno vprašanje: Ali naj program sam računa aki je število praštevilo, ali pa ta števila veš že poprej ? _________________ Dokler bodo ljudje mislili, da živali ne čutijo, bodo živali čutile, da ljudje ne mislijo. |
|
Nazaj na vrh |
|
 |
twom Član


Pridružen-a: Ned 26 Okt 2003 0:37 Prispevkov: 986 Aktiv.: 4.15 Kraj: Ljubljana
|
Objavljeno: Sre Maj 28, 2008 2:33 pm Naslov sporočila: |
|
|
Običajno nastavljam attenuator...
Včasih bi kakšno zanko ponovil v samo dveh fiksnih korakih (npr att = 10 in 45 dB), pa bi želel čim bolj elegantno kodo.
Eni pravijo da 1 ni praštevilo, 0 pa tudi število baje ni .
Lp,
Peter |
|
Nazaj na vrh |
|
 |
gumby Član


Pridružen-a: Sob 28 Apr 2007 12:32 Prispevkov: 4066 Aktiv.: 18.36
|
Objavljeno: Sre Maj 28, 2008 2:44 pm Naslov sporočila: |
|
|
switch ne bi bil primernejši za to?
edit: ups, narobe razumel problem...
Najenostavneje bo, če lepo definiraš eno tabelo in preko indeksa dobiš željeno vrednost:
Koda: |
#define tab_max 16
const int tabela[tab_max]={0, 1, 2, 3, 5, 7, 11, 13, 17, 19, 23, 29, 31, 37, 41, 43};
int i;
for(i=0;i<tab_max;i++)
{
nekaj=tabela[i];
} |
_________________ Tule nisem več aktiven. |
|
Nazaj na vrh |
|
 |
|
|
Ne, ne moreš dodajati novih tem v tem forumu Ne, ne moreš odgovarjati na teme v tem forumu Ne, ne moreš urejati svojih prispevkov v tem forumu Ne, ne moreš brisati svojih prispevkov v tem forumu Ne ne moreš glasovati v anketi v tem forumu Ne, ne moreš pripeti datotek v tem forumu Ne, ne moreš povleči datotek v tem forumu
|
Uptime: 9 dni
Powered by phpBB © 2001, 2005 phpBB Group
|